Preferably, on a regular schedule. My K9s and War Dogs eat at 8:00 A.M. and 4:00 P.M. with the amount adjusted for how heavily they've been working.
Barring the necessity of special diets, most important is keeping them on a regular schedule. They can tolerate large deviations when needed. But, vary it only if required and supplement with treats until you can next feed 'em.
Be consistent.

Some examples of dog treats that take a long time for dogs to eat are bully sticks, rawhide chews, and dental chews. These treats are designed to provide dogs with a longer-lasting chewing experience.
